Transaction e90b43ee15a7ec0d869f81685dbdb9912a126c232db389ec950761981a49312c

1 Input
2 Outputs
  • e90b43ee15a7ec0d869f81685dbdb9912a126c232db389ec950761981a49312c:0
  • value  799110
    address  17ZFgSQZ5M2Jz9sh313bH4J7MWuZoq16Lv
  • e90b43ee15a7ec0d869f81685dbdb9912a126c232db389ec950761981a49312c:1
  • value  18704884
    address  115tTYNCzAE7Yj9ifKKZLzX5zjhuXgxBEC